Why Special Towing for Sports Cars?
Sports cars often have low ground clearance, high-performance engines, and sensitive bodywork. Standard towing methods can cause damage, making specialized towing essential. Proper equipment and techniques are needed to avoid scratches, dents, or mechanical issues.
Key Considerations for Sports Car Towing
Flatbed Towing
Flatbed towing is the preferred method for sports car towing The entire vehicle is placed on a flatbed truck, preventing any contact with the road and reducing the risk of damage. This method keeps the car secure and stable during transport.
Experience and Expertise
Choose a towing service with experience in handling sports cars. Professionals who understand the specific needs of high-performance vehicles will take extra precautions to ensure safe transport.
Equipment
Ensure the towing company uses the right equipment, such as low-angle flatbed trucks and soft straps. These tools help in loading and securing the car without causing damage.

Steps to Take When Towing a Sports Car
Find a Reputable Towing Service
Research and select a towing company known for handling sports cars. Check reviews and ask for recommendations from other sports car owners.
Communicate Your Needs
Clearly explain to the towing company that you need specialized sports car towing. Provide details about your car’s make and model so they can prepare accordingly.
Inspect the Towing Equipment
Before your car is loaded, inspect the towing equipment. Ensure that the flatbed truck and straps are in good condition and suitable for your car.
Supervise the Process
If possible, be present during the loading and unloading of your sports car. Supervise the process to ensure your vehicle is handled with care.
